SEVEN SIOUX: Argue Again: CD

Nov 28, 2006

This appears to be the work of an older Austrian band, who have re-recorded some of their tunes. The results fall kinda in a less abrasive post-Leatherface poppy punk void where some of the tunes aren’t too bad but the vast majority just fail to stick to the wall.

 –jimmy (Fettkakao)